About #0FA800

At its core, #0FA800 is a dark and vivid hue. Designers often compare it to the standard color Limegreen. In the RGB color space, it consists of 15 red, 168 green, and 0 blue.

When sending designs containing this color to a printer, the CMYK values come into play. Its ink density profile breaks down to 91% cyan, 0% magenta, 100% yellow, and 34% black. Always request a physical proof before doing a large print run with this exact code.

Color Space Conversions

HEX#0FA800
RGB15, 168, 0
HSL114.6°, 100.0%, 32.9%
CMYK91%, 0%, 100%, 34%
HSV114.6°, 100.0%, 65.9%
LAB60.0, -62.2, 61.0
XYZ14.2, 28.1, 4.7
Decimal1026048
